General Rate Increase (GRI) – sea freight rate increases explained

As from March 1st 2012 shipping lines offering Asia-Europe services will be increasing sea freight rates within this market by up to an astonishing 750usd per TEU, close to 100% increase. WHY? Shipping Lines are saying that with the current rates they are just covering the costs of their fuel, so they need to increase

Thailand Floods!

Heavy monsoon rainfalls continue to cause severe flooding in Thailand, creating havoc and causing massive disruption to sea and air freight.
